|   i am calculating the phonon frequencies of MgB2. i got nice match in bulk 
modulus of 156 GPa with LDA. While the experimental value is 151 GPa.
|    
|   With that Pseudopotential when i tried to calculate the phonon frequency by 
Vibra. i got -ve frequencies.....
|    
|   can any body suggest, what can i do???

Bipul:
You must obtain three acoustic modes with the frequencies close enough
to zero, as the lowest eigenvalues. If they are ~ 0.01, either positive
or negative, that's fine. If any of them largely deviates from zero,
that is a indication that are not good because you have eggbox effect,
as a result the acoustic sum rule is not satisfied with sufficient
accuracy. You can check the eggbox effect prior to phonon calculation:
displace all atoms uniformely, look at the variation of forces;
the sum of forces over all atoms in each cartesian direction must be
less than, at most, 0.1. Increase Mesh Cutoff to control the eggbox.
Good equilibrium lattice constant and bulk modulus are good indication that
the calculation is generally sane; however they are not so sensitive
to the eggbox as the forces (and hence phonons) are.
